Tired of hitting keys by accident on the Touch Bar? Hide My Bar allows you to hide the Touch Bar so you can avoid accidental taps. Hide My Bar provides shortcuts so you can hide / show the Touch Bar in an instant without disturbing your workflow. It works out of the box, no specific settings required! It also works seamlessly with other Touch Bar applications such as BetterTouchTool.
